The Plinko Board in a Nutshell

Picture a tall, narrow board crowded with evenly spaced pegs—each one a tiny obstacle that nudges the ball left or right as it falls. The goal is simple: drop the ball from the top, let gravity do its thing, and watch it land in one of the numbered slots at the bottom.

The slots aren’t just numbers; they’re multipliers that transform your stake into winnings. From a modest 0.2× to an eye‑catching 1 000×, each slot holds its own mystery.

Because the drops are random, no two plays look identical. That unpredictability is what keeps casual players coming back for another quick spin.

How a Ball Plays Its Part

When you hit “Drop,” the ball sits at the apex and then begins its descent. At each peg, it might bounce left or right—nothing more complicated than a coin toss, but it feels dramatic because of the visual cue.

The journey takes only a couple of seconds. In fact, the average round lasts between two to three seconds, so you can complete dozens of rounds before you even notice the time passing.

Because nothing else happens on the screen during that brief interval—no spinning reels or flashing lights—the focus stays on the ball’s path.

Betting Basics and Risk Levels

You can wager as little as €0.10 per drop or go all the way up to €1 000. But most casual players settle in a range that feels comfortable for short bursts.

  • Low risk: Small bets; higher chance of landing on lower multipliers.
  • Medium risk: Moderate bets; balanced odds between small and large wins.
  • High risk: Larger bets; small probability of hitting huge multipliers.

The adjustable risk level is one of Plinko’s unique selling points—it lets players fine‑tune how often they see small wins versus chasing that big multiplier.

The Rarity of Big Multipliers

The multipliers are spread across the board like this:

  • 0.2× – almost guaranteed on low risk.
  • 0.5× – common in medium risk settings.
  • 1× – frequent across all risk levels.
  • 2× – appears moderately often within medium risk.
  • 5× – rare but doable on medium risk.
  • 10× – uncommon on high risk but still possible.
  • 100× – very rare; usually only hit on high risk with larger bets.
  • A maximum multiplier up to 1 000× – extremely rare; typically only appears when risking higher stakes on high risk levels.

The distribution is heavily skewed toward lower multipliers, which explains why most players experience quick wins rather than life‑changing payouts.
